Table 1.

Correlation between miR-183 expression and clinicopathological factors of HCC.

Factors n miR-183 level 2−ΔΔCT M (P25~P75) r P*
Gender
 Male 79 9.178 (2.564~29.231) −0.023 0.827
 Female 13 6.431 (3.886~16.491)
Age (years)
 ≤55 50 8.415 (2.715~31.069) −0.002 0.981
 >55 42 10.543 (2.583~23.855)
HBV
 + 72 8.880 (2.687~21.728) −0.078 0.887
 − 20 10.2773 (2.646~47.116)
HCV
 + 6 12.556 (0.830~99.732) −0.002 0.985
 − 86 9.015 (2.715~23.855)
Liver cirrhosis
 Yes 86 9.845 (2.761~29.437) 0.235 0.025
 No 6 3.007 (1.606~4.862)
Child-Pugh score
 A 77 8.583 (2.615~29.643) 0.046 0.661
 B 15 10.920 (4.737~19.942)
AFP (ng/mL)
 ≤400 52 10.525 (2.588~26.252) −0.040 0.705
 >400 40 8.026 (2.799~28.121)
Tumor number
 1 59 7.803 (2.961~33.794) 0.064 0.544
 ≥2 33 10.235 (3.989~24.257)
Tumor size (cm)
 ≤3 12 8.717 (2.799~29.403) 0.027 0.799
 >3 80 10.547 (2.223~22.574)
Vein invasion
 Yes 25 9.178 (4.228~19.525) 0.014 0.892
 No 67 8.583 (1.564~33.794)
TNM grade
 I-II 46 5.480 (2.381~11.794) 0.213 0.042
 III-IV 46 11.795 (4.231~33.874)
Tumor grade
 W 22 4.754 (1.656~68.768) −0.060 0.365
 M 48 10.047 (3.010~28.786)
 P 22 7.229 (2.190~11.677)

*The Spearman correlation coefficients were used to analyze the correlation between miR-183 expression and clinicopathological factors; P < 0.05 was considered statistically significant; W: well differentiated; M: moderately differentiated; P: poorly differentiated; HBV: hepatitis B virus; HCV: hepatitis C virus; r: correlation coefficient; TNM: tumor node metastasis; AFP: alpha-fetoprotein.
